Virginia Commonwealth University offers an exceptional summer program for pre-dentistry, medicine, pharmacy, and physical therapy students. The Summer Academic Enrichment Program (SAEP) is a six-week academic intensive, in-residence program for junior, senior, and post-bacc students. Students from across the nation and across disciplines join together to build skills and experiences to prepare for health professional school. Program highlights include biological science coursework, clinical laboratory experiences, test-taking strategies, professional development, and mock interviews. Program stipend and housing provided.
